IWS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2018 in Review

503 of the 4,374 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in iShares Russell Mid-Cap Value ETF (IWS) for Q3 2018, worth a combined $7.98B — up 5% from $7.59B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 40 funds opened new IWS positions and 27 closed out — a net gain of 13 holders — while 160 added to existing stakes and 146 trimmed.

The largest buyer was American Century Companies, adding an estimated $146M. The largest seller was Level Four Advisory Services, cutting an estimated $28.2M.
